Output 62f58bb3f144c1a24ac7fb7e4f2fa0597c362c86a3019a6736be853ccc469e24:19

value
14188547
script pubkey
OP_0 OP_PUSHBYTES_20 d51e3c1a2791f414a6ec2e02e4711d8a9b2885c9
address
ltc1q650rcx38j86pffhv9cpwguga32dj3pwf6hnvq4
transaction
62f58bb3f144c1a24ac7fb7e4f2fa0597c362c86a3019a6736be853ccc469e24
spent
true